This video provides a book review for "The Makarov Pistol" by Henry Brown and Cameron White. The reviewer discusses the book's strengths as a collector's guide, highlighting its detailed information on Soviet and East German Makarov variants, serial number dating schemes, and accessories like ammunition and holsters. While acknowledging its self-published nature and less sophisticated aesthetics compared to premium firearm literature, the reviewer emphasizes the book's valuable content, especially for beginning collectors, and its affordability in both paperback and Kindle formats.
